Understanding Botox Injection in Facial Aesthetics

Botox Injection in facial aesthetics is a minimally invasive approach designed to temporarily reduce the activity of specific facial muscles. These muscles are responsible for creating expression lines that become more visible over time due to repeated movement.

The treatment is widely discussed in aesthetic dermatology for its role in softening dynamic wrinkles without altering natural facial structure. It focuses on controlled muscle relaxation rather than volume enhancement, making it different from fillers or surgical options.

How Botox Works on Facial Muscles

Botox functions by blocking nerve signals that trigger muscle contractions. When injected in targeted facial areas, it reduces excessive movement that contributes to fine lines and deeper wrinkles.

Key functional points include:

  • Temporarily relaxing overactive facial muscles
  • Reducing repetitive folding of the skin
  • Allowing smoother skin texture over time
  • Maintaining natural facial expressions when applied correctly

The mechanism is localized, meaning only selected muscles are affected while surrounding areas continue normal movement.

Treatment Areas in Facial Rejuvenation

Botox Injection is applied in specific facial zones where muscle activity is most responsible for visible aging signs.

Common treatment areas include:

  • Forehead lines caused by repeated eyebrow movement
  • Glabellar lines between the eyebrows
  • Periorbital lines near the outer eye region
  • Jawline tension in cases of muscle overactivity
  • Chin dimpling caused by hyperactive mentalis muscle

Each area requires careful assessment to maintain natural expression dynamics.

Procedure Overview and Clinical Approach

The Botox procedure is generally straightforward and performed in a controlled clinical environment. It involves precise micro-injections using fine needles into targeted facial muscles.

Typical procedural steps include:

  • Facial assessment and expression analysis
  • Identification of active muscle zones
  • Marking injection points for accuracy
  • Small, controlled injections into selected muscles
  • Short observation period after application

The process is typically quick, with minimal interruption to daily activities, depending on individual response.

Aftercare and Skin Response

Post-treatment care plays a role in optimizing aesthetic outcomes and maintaining even distribution of the product within targeted muscles.

General aftercare guidance includes:

  • Avoiding excessive facial pressure for a short period
  • Limiting intense physical activity immediately after treatment
  • Keeping the head in an upright position for several hours
  • Allowing time for gradual onset of visible changes

Initial effects develop gradually as muscle activity reduces, followed by smoother skin appearance in treated areas.

FAQs

What makes Botox different from other facial treatments?

Botox targets muscle activity, while other treatments may focus on volume restoration or skin resurfacing.

How long does Botox influence facial muscles?

The effect is temporary and gradually reduces as muscle activity returns over time.

Does Botox change natural facial expressions?

When applied accurately, it softens excessive movement while maintaining natural expression patterns.

Can Botox be used for preventive aging?

Yes, it is often considered in early stages of facial line development to slow visible aging signs.
